From cd45f6ef14b7140b77d28b38b9f0a7f7d93ed52b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ajith P V Date: Wed, 22 Jan 2025 13:25:44 +0530 Subject: [PATCH] staging: gpib: fix prefixing 0x with decimal output - pr_err() of pc2a_common_attach() in pc2_gpib uses 0x%d. - The config->ibbase is of u32 and correct prefix is 0x%x. - This error reported by checkpatch with below message: ERROR: Prefixing 0x with decimal output is defective Signed-off-by: Ajith P V Link: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20250122075545.33146-1-ajithpv.linux@gmail.com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man --- drivers/staging/gpib/pc2/pc2_gpib.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/drivers/staging/gpib/pc2/pc2_gpib.c b/drivers/staging/gpib/pc2/pc2_gpib.c index c0b07cb63d9ac..6a1c0cb1d0ed2 100644 --- a/drivers/staging/gpib/pc2/pc2_gpib.c +++ b/drivers/staging/gpib/pc2/pc2_gpib.c @@ -505,7 +505,7 @@ static int pc2a_common_attach(gpib_board_t *board, const gpib_board_config_t *co case 0x62e1: break; default: - pr_err("PCIIa base range invalid, must be one of 0x[0246]2e1, but is 0x%d\n", + pr_err("PCIIa base range invalid, must be one of 0x[0246]2e1, but is 0x%x\n", config->ibbase); return -1; } -- 2.47.2
